Yingfang Ma is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Yingfang Ma has authored 8 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Electrical and Electronic Engineering, 5 papers in Biomedical Engineering and 4 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Yingfang Ma’s work include Terahertz technology and applications (4 papers), Metamaterials and Metasurfaces Applications (4 papers) and Plasmonic and Surface Plasmon Research (4 papers). Yingfang Ma is often cited by papers focused on Terahertz technology and applications (4 papers), Metamaterials and Metasurfaces Applications (4 papers) and Plasmonic and Surface Plasmon Research (4 papers). Yingfang Ma collaborates with scholars based in United States, China and United Kingdom. Yingfang Ma's co-authors include Jiaguang Han, Ranjan Singh, Zhen Tian, Jianqiang Gu and Weili Zhang and has published in prestigious journals such as Nature Communications, Applied Physics Letters and Physical Chemistry Chemical Physics.
